Instacart and Pinterest to Launch New Retail Media Collaboration

Instacart and Pinterest are enhancing brands’ Pinterest campaigns by providing high-intent audiences powered by Instacart data. The new collaboration aims to connect Pinterest users with the products they love, in the exact moment they’re planning to use them, whether they’re meal-prepping for the week, planning a backyard movie night, or redecorating an office.

In the initial phase of the partnership, select brands advertising on Pinterest will be able to advertise their products to Instacart first-party audience segments—built from real-world retail purchase behavior—to reach high-intent consumers with more precision. A second phase is expected to introduce closed-loop measurement, which would tie Pinterest ads to actual product sales across the Instacart Marketplace of over 1,800 retailers, and help prove campaign impact with real purchase data.

FOX Advertising Launches Brand Storytelling Program With Investment in Lighthouse

FOX Advertising announced a strategic investment in The Lighthouse, the innovative studio and campus space designed specifically for Creators to collaborate and develop content. The investment will also support the launch of FOX’s new IP development initiative aimed at fueling Creator-led franchises across its content portfolio.

At a time when brands and media companies are seeking immersive, IP-first ecosystems that blend content, commerce and culture, this strategic investment will further strengthen FOX’s commitment to Creator-powered innovation and content creation.

At Cannes Lions, Adobe announced innovations in GenStudio, its all-in-one content platform that optimizes the process of planning, creating, managing and measuring marketing content. The latest offerings will fuse creativity, marketing and AI to help businesses quickly produce personalized, on-brand content at scale.

Adobe will enhance GenStudio for Performance Marketing—a generative AI-first application for creating on-brand ads, emails and more—with AI-powered capabilities for video and display advertising, while enabling businesses to build and optimize their ad creative for multiple platforms including Amazon Ads, Google Campaign Manager 360, LinkedIn and Meta. These innovations will enable faster campaign deployment and more sophisticated personalization at scale. Adobe also enhanced Firefly Services, Custom Models and Adobe Express to streamline content creation for teams.

NiCE CXone Mpower Builds on Snowflake AI to Unlock Secure, Scalable CX Automation

NiCE announced a strategic collaboration with Snowflake, the AI Data Cloud company, to unlock the full value of customer interaction data by enabling seamless, secure data sharing across the front, middle and back office through Snowflake Secure Data Sharing. This collaboration combines NiCE CXone Mpower’s industry-leading AI for customer service automation with Snowflake’s easy, connected, and trusted platform, enabling joint customers to seamlessly access and update data to automate customer service at scale. By working with Snowflake, the two companies will be able to deliver immediate value for customers and unlock new opportunities across the enterprise landscape.

Amazon Ads and Roku, Inc. announced a new integration that gives advertisers access to the largest authenticated CTV footprint in the U.S. exclusively through Amazon DSP. The new collaboration delivers logged-in reach to an estimated 80M U.S. Connected TV (CTV) households, representing more than 80% of U.S. CTV households according to ComScore data. Unlocking an addressable CTV audience at such unprecedented scale will drive improved performance, planning, optimization, and measurement for all advertisers, further enabling CTV as a true performance solution. The exclusive partnership between two leaders in CTV enhances addressability across major streaming apps including The Roku Channel, Prime Video, and other leading CTV streaming services on Roku and Fire TV operating systems; popular streaming services already available, including Disney, FOX Corporation, Paramount, Tubi, and Warner Bros Discovery; and all premium publishers.
